lzth.net
当前位置:首页 >> 【C语言】化学狗误入此课...一道编程题...求大佬帮... >>

【C语言】化学狗误入此课...一道编程题...求大佬帮...

C语言程序: #include <stdio.h>int main(){ long num; long temp, f; int i; printf("请输入正整数:"); scanf("%ld", &num); temp = num; while(temp > 0) { f = 1; while(temp > 0) { if(temp % 10 == 0) { temp /= 10; continue; } f *= temp % 10; temp /=

#include <stdio.h>#define N 15int fun(int a[]){int i,j,k,m=N;for(i=0;i<m-1;i++)for(j=i+1;j<m;j++)if(a[j]==a[i]){for(k=j;k<m-1;k++)a[k]=a[k+1];m--;i--;}return m;}void main(){int i,k,a[N];for(i=0;i<N;i++){scanf("%d",&a[i]);if(a[i]<=0){printf("输入的第%d个数

#includeint main(void){printf("%s\n","你是一条傻狗");return 0;}

代码: 运行结果:

#include int main(){int n,i,j,s=0; struct stud{ char id[10]; char name[10]; int score; }stu[10]; scanf("%d",&n); for(i=j=0;istu[j].score)j=i; } printf("The average score=%.2f\n",(float)s/n); printf("The student who has the highest score is:%s %s %d",stu[j].id,stu[j].name,stu[j].score); return 0;}

一个递归函数就可以了.下面是代码:参数sum传递前必须初始化0.代码实现原理:通过递归从第n项开始往前累加.#include<stdio.h>#include<math.h>float sumN(int n,float *sum);int main(){ int n; float sum=0;//sum必须初始化0 printf("输入N

#include void main(){ int i,j,m,sum=0; for(i=1;i<=1000;i++){ int arr[1000],k=0; for(j=1;j<=i/2;j++){ if(i%j==0){ arr[k++]=j } } for(m=0;m<1000;m++){ sum+=arr[m]; } if(i==sum){ printf("%d ",i); } }}

#include <stdio.h>int main(){int k;scanf("%d",&k);while(k--){int p[10];int q,w,e,r=0,t;scanf("%d %d %d",&q,&w,&e);//q为 考试科目数 w为平均分 e为单科分数线t=q;while(q--){scanf("%d",&p[r]);r++;}//循环结束后 r为考试科目数.int lx=0;while(

#include<stdio.h>#include<math.h>main(){ int n,i,j; double x[50],y[50],l,min; while(1){ scanf("%d",&n); for(i=0;i<n;i++) scanf("%lf%lf",&x[i],&y[i]); min=sqrt(pow(x[0]-x[1],2)+pow(y[0]-y[1],2)); 4102for(i=1;i<n;i++) for(j=0;j<i;j++){ l=sqrt(pow(x[j]-x[i],2)

#include <stdio.h>void outputstar(int n);void main(){int m;scanf("%d",&m);outputstar(m);}void outputstar(int n){int i,j;for(i=1;i<=n;i++){for(j=0;j<=n-i;j++)printf(" ");for(j=0;j<i*2-1;j++)printf("* ");printf("\n");}}//运行示例:

相关文档
网站首页 | 网站地图
All rights reserved Powered by www.lzth.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com